Seed cotton, unginned — Producer Price Index in Niger
Niger: Seed cotton, unginned — Producer Price Index was 131.31 in 2025. ▲ Rising
Seed cotton, unginned — Producer Price Index in Niger, 1991–2025
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ations.
Analysis
Niger recorded 131.31 for seed cotton, unginned — producer price index in 2025. That is the highest value across all 35 years on record.
That represents a change of up 12.5% on the previous year and up 31.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, seed cotton, unginned — producer price index in Niger peaked at 131.31 in 2025 and was at its lowest, 44.47, in 1993.
Niger ranks 21st of 61 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 35 years of available data.

About this data
This sub-domain contains data on agriculture producer prices and the producer price index. Agriculture producer prices are prices received by farmers for primary crops, live animals and livestock primary products as collected at the point of initial sale (prices paid at the farm gate). Annual data are provided from 1991 (while mothly data start in January 2010) for 180 countries and 212 products. The producer price index is the index of agricultural producer prices that measures the average annual change over time in the selling prices received by farmers (prices at the farm gate or at the first point of sale). The three categories of producer price index available in FAOSTAT comprise: single-item price index, commodity group index and the agriculture producer price index.
